Overview:
**Role**:Work Request Authority (WRA) Manager
**Location**:Brisbane, Queensland
- On site
We are seeking a skilled and experienced individual to join our Brisbane team as a Work Request Authority (WRA) Manager. This is a key role within the CBGU Rail Operations team. The primary responsibility of the WRA Manager is to coordinate access to the system under testing and commissioning without impacting train movements or the integrity of the system, we invite you to apply.
**Key Responsibilities**:
- Overall management of the assets within the T&C zone:
- Responsible and accountable for the work request authority process and associated procedure
- Chair regular meetings (WRA Panel) to coordinate WRA from various stakeholders
- Establish a 4 week outlook window of authorized works
- Review controls proposed to mitigate risks to workers
- Organise lessons learnt from experience
- Coordinate resourcing needs with the Rail Operations Planner
- Prioritise access to the system based on overall projects’ priority
- Consult with programmer/planner
**Qualifications and Experience**:
- Management or business qualification, either as part of degree or later.
- Management or supervision of multi-functional technical teams in a rail environment.
- Experience in asset maintenance / planning or logistics.
- Good knowledge of rail systems and infrastructure components.
- Excellent understanding of safety regulations, standards, and best practices within the rail industry.
- Proficiency in relevant software tools and systems used for testing, commissioning, and project management.
